I was interested to learn actually how plastics such as bottles and carrier bags can be turned into fabrics, and found a gardening website that describes how the process is done to create their gardening gloves.
Step 1.
Empty plastic beverage bottles are collected, sorted, crushed & baled at a recycling center. Then ground into flakes, & screened and washed to remove caps, labels & contaminants.
Step 2.
The flakes are heated, further screened and cleaned, dried and placed in a vented extruder. The extruded plastic is cooled and then thoroughly chopped to make plastic pellets.
Step 3.
The pellets are sent to a yarn manufacturing facility where they are melted & spun into polyester fiber. The recycled PET fibers are blended with new PET fibers and spun into polyester yarn.
Step 4.
The polyester yarn is sent to a mill for knitting or weaving into fabric.

For the use of swimwear, the fibres from the plastics will have to be blended with other materials to give them stretch. An example of a fibre it could be blended with is nylon, which is readily used for swimwear, and can also be recycled.
